The Kalyan Minaret stands in Bukhara’s old city as a 12th‑century brick tower within the Po-i-Kalyan complex; visitors come for Islamic architecture and the surrounding historic bazaar.
The Kalyan Minaret is a prominent medieval tower in the historic centre of Bukhara, Uzbekistan and forms the focal point of the Po-i-Kalyan religious complex. It dates to the early 12th century and is one of the city’s best-known monuments.
The minaret is viewed together with its adjacent mosque and madrasa, creating a compact ensemble of monumental Islamic architecture. The tower’s scale and decoration make it a major photographic and cultural landmark within Bukhara’s old city.
Erected during Karakhanid rule in the 12th century, the tower served both liturgical and defensive purposes and later became integrated into successive Islamic and local political regimes. It survived major historical upheavals and remains a key surviving example of regional minaret architecture.
Situated in central Bukhara within the Po-i-Kalyan complex, the minaret overlooks the old city’s streets and is easily accessed from Bukhara’s historic core.
- 12th-century origin: Constructed in the early 12th century under Karakhanid rule and known for surviving multiple historical sieges and invasions.
- Notable height and location: Stands at roughly 45 meters tall and is a central feature of Bukhara's historic Po-i-Kalyan complex near the old city.
What to See #
- Kalyan Minaret: A freestanding tapering tower that served as the minaret of the main mosque in the Po-i-Kalyan complex and functioned historically as a call-to-prayer tower and watchtower.
- Kalyan Mosque: A large congregational mosque built beside the minaret that forms part of the same religious and architectural ensemble in central Bukhara.
- Mir-i-Arab Madrasa: A historic Islamic seminary located adjacent to the mosque-minaret complex, known for its teaching role from the 16th century onward.
How to Get to Kalyan Minaret #
The minaret sits in the center of Bukhara’s historic district, adjacent to the Kalyan Mosque and the Mir-i-Arab Madrasa. It is a short walk from the city’s main bazaar and a central point on most walking tours of old Bukhara.
Tips for Visiting Kalyan Minaret #
- Climb the minaret early in the morning to avoid midday heat; the spiral stair is steep and offers close views of Bukhara's skyline.
- Look closely at the fired-brick banding and Kufic inscriptions-these details tell the story of 12th-13th-century construction techniques.
- Combine the minaret visit with the Lyab-i-Hauz ensemble and other nearby madrasahs for a day of Bukhara's architecture.

Weather & Climate near Kalyan Minaret #
Kalyan Minaret's climate is classified as Cold Desert - Cold Desert climate with hot summers (peaking in July) and cold winters (coldest in January). Temperatures range from -3°C to 37°C. Very dry conditions with minimal rainfall with a pronounced dry season.
